Description

Fissistigma rufinerve (also called Red-veined Fissistigma, among many other common names) is a species of flowering plant in the family Annonaceae. It is a shrub or small tree, up to 8 m tall, with a trunk up to 30 cm in diameter. It is native to Southeast Asia, from Thailand to the Philippines. It grows in lowland rainforests and along rivers.

Flower, Seeds and Seedlings

Fissistigma rufinerve has small, yellow-green flowers with five petals. The seeds are small and black, and the seedlings have oval-shaped leaves.
